A pair of Wehrmacht Enlisted personnel belt buckles, including a Heer buckle, constructed of magnetic metal, the obverse bearing a raised Heer style German national eagle clutching a mobile swastika, within a ribbed ring bearing an inscription of GOTT MIT UNS (GOD WITH US) and oak leaf branches, the reverse with a loop and swivel attachment claws retaining a period original brown leather strap, the latter maker marked B.
